Mx-5 single centre wiper arm for the Mk 1/2 and 2.5's

Postby Mazda Mender » Sun Feb 01, 2015 7:26 pm

This is the first test of the single centre wiper arm kit for the MK 1/2/2.5 Mx-5 Roadsters, Eunos, Miata's, we are using the standard 18" wiper blade in this test but will go out and get a 21" to see how better it works.
